Understanding the Basics of Nuclear Equations



Before diving into specific worksheet answers, it's crucial to grasp the fundamental principles governing nuclear equations. These equations represent changes within the atomic nucleus, involving protons, neutrons, and various particles. The key to understanding them lies in appreciating the conservation laws involved:

Conservation of Mass Number (A) and Atomic Number (Z)



In every nuclear reaction, the total mass number (A, the sum of protons and neutrons) and the total atomic number (Z, the number of protons) must remain constant. This principle forms the bedrock of balancing nuclear equations.

Common Types of Nuclear Reactions



Several types of nuclear reactions commonly appear in worksheets:

Alpha Decay (α): Emission of an alpha particle (²⁴He). This reduces the atomic number by 2 and the mass number by 4.
Beta Decay (β⁻): Emission of a beta particle (⁰₋₁e). This increases the atomic number by 1 while the mass number remains unchanged.
Positron Emission (β⁺): Emission of a positron (⁰₁e). This decreases the atomic number by 1 while the mass number remains unchanged.
Gamma Decay (γ): Emission of a gamma ray (high-energy photon). This doesn't change the atomic number or mass number.
Neutron Emission (n): Emission of a neutron (¹₀n). This reduces the mass number by 1 while the atomic number remains unchanged.
Nuclear Fission: A heavy nucleus splits into smaller nuclei.
Nuclear Fusion: Two light nuclei combine to form a heavier nucleus.


Balancing Nuclear Equations: A Step-by-Step Approach



Balancing nuclear equations follows a straightforward process:

1. Identify the unknown: Determine the missing particle or nucleus in the equation.
2. Apply conservation laws: Ensure the sum of mass numbers (A) and atomic numbers (Z) are equal on both sides of the equation.
3. Solve for the unknown: Use the conservation laws to determine the mass number and atomic number of the unknown particle or nucleus.
4. Write the complete equation: Substitute the values you calculated into the nuclear equation.


Example Nuclear Equations and Solutions



Let's work through a couple of examples to solidify your understanding. Remember to always check for conservation of mass number and atomic number.

Example 1: ²³⁸U → ⁴He + ?

Solution: The mass number on the left side is 238. On the right side, we have 4 (from the alpha particle). Therefore, the missing mass number is 238 - 4 = 234. The atomic number on the left is 92 (Uranium). On the right, we have 2 (from the alpha particle). The missing atomic number is 92 - 2 = 90. This corresponds to Thorium (Th). The complete balanced equation is: ²³⁸U → ⁴He + ²³⁴Th

Example 2: ¹⁴C → ¹⁴N + ?

Solution: The mass number remains unchanged (14). The atomic number on the left is 6 and on the right is 7. Thus, the missing particle must have an atomic number of -1 and a mass number of 0 which is a Beta Particle. The complete balanced equation is: ¹⁴C → ¹⁴N + ⁰₋₁e

FAQs



1. What is the difference between alpha and beta decay? Alpha decay involves the emission of an alpha particle (two protons and two neutrons), reducing both the atomic and mass numbers. Beta decay involves the emission of a beta particle (an electron), increasing the atomic number while the mass number stays the same.

2. How do I identify an unknown isotope in a nuclear equation? Use the conservation of mass number (A) and atomic number (Z) to solve for the unknown isotope's mass number and atomic number. Then consult a periodic table to identify the element.

4. What is the significance of gamma decay? Gamma decay doesn't change the atomic or mass number, but it releases high-energy photons, reducing the energy of the nucleus.

5. Can nuclear fission and fusion be represented by nuclear equations? Absolutely! Nuclear fission and fusion are complex reactions but can still be represented by balanced equations showing the reactants (parent nuclei) and products (daughter nuclei and other particles). However, balancing these equations can be more challenging due to the potential for multiple products.
